The Papin family has been taking care of Chateau Pierre Bise, located in Beaulieu sur Layon, in the heart of Layon, for several generations, a 55 hectare estate managed by Claude and Joêlle Papin with the help of their two sons René and Christophe
The vineyard is planted on a soil of schists, spilites and carboniferous sandstone.
Grape variety: 100% Chenin blanc
Color: intense golden yellow with orange highlights.
Tasting: very good balance with an intense minerality. Rich accents of yellow fruits and smoke with hints of pollen.
Food and wine pairing: ask to be served between 10 and 12 ° C on a escalope of foie gras with apples or on blue-veined cheeses such as Fourme d'Ambert or Bleu d'Auvergne.
Aging potential: several decades during which the wine will acquire great qualities.
